ksmbd: limits exceeding the maximum allowable outstanding requests

commit b589f5db6d4af8f14d70e31e1276b4c017668a26 upstream.

If the client ignores the CreditResponse received from the server and
continues to send the request, ksmbd limits the requests if it exceeds
smb2 max credits.
